Dektak 3ST (Stylus Profiler) aka "III-V Profiler"

 
The profiler placed in 346-904 (Dektak 3ST).

The Dektak 3ST is intended for profile measurements on samples outside the cleanroom. It is located in the basement, building 346, room 904.


The user manual, technical information and contact information can be found in LabManager.

The computer connected to the Dektak 3ST is pretty old and runs Windows 98 SE. It is not connected to the network but traces can be saved on either USB memory stick or floppy disk. The USB driver is an old universal driver and has been shown to work with small size USB sticks. However it did not work with an 8GB Kingston stick.

Performance and Process Parameters

Performance Vertical Range
  • 65 kÅ, 655 kÅ, 1310 kÅ
Scan length range
  • 50-50000 µm
Stylus track force
  • Recommended: 3-10 mg, depending on the softness of the surface
Scan speed ranges
  • High speed: 3s for 50µm to 50000µm
  • Medium speed: 12s for 50µm to 10000µm
  • Low speed: 50s
Materials Allowed substrate materials
  • III-V
  • Silicon
  • polymer
